RCOE SCE vs. Westchester College of Nursing & Allied Health
Both Riverside County Office of Education-School of Career Education and Westchester College of Nursing & Allied Health are Less than 2 years schools located in California. The following statements compare Riverside County Office of Education-School of Career Education and Westchester College of Nursing & Allied Health with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Westchester College of Nursing & Allied Health's tuition ($29,080) is more expensive than RCOE SCE ($12,300).
- Westchester College of Nursing & Allied Health's students to faculty ratio (6 to 1) is lower than RCOE SCE (15 to 1).
- RCOE SCE (105 students) is larger than Westchester College of Nursing & Allied Health (11 students) with more enrolled students.
- Westchester College of Nursing & Allied Health ($9,184) has higher amount of financial aid than RCOE SCE ($7,604).
- Westchester College of Nursing & Allied Health's graduation rate (100%) is higher than RCOE SCE (82%).
